Re: Is CygWin the thing for UNIX compatible web development on Windows?


Hi Raith,

> I would be grateful for even a simple yes/no answer to my dilemma... (I am
> completely new to CygWin and I did read the FAQ)
>
> I want to use my Windows computer to develop a web site that will be hosted
> on UNIX and needs to use some UNIXy features; symbolic links, the passwd
> program for controlling HTaccess password files and some sort of email
> sender (sendmail?).
>
> I am currently using the Win32 ports of Apache, PHP4, MySQL and Perl and
> this works great but I am unable to use the features I mentioned above. Is
> CygWin a likely solution to my problem? I presume I'll also need to find
> CygWin compatible binary distros of Apache, PHP4, MySQL and Perl (I don't
> want to convert/compile them myself).

You may use the cygwin ports of Apache 1.3.x and PHP 4.x to develop on a Win32
system and copy the same setup to a UNIX based machine

Check these URLs

    http://www.student.uni-koeln.de/cygwin/
    http://apache.dev.wapme.net/
